FSC 220 - Occupational Safety and Health for the Fire Service


This course introduces the basic concepts of occupational health and safety as it relates to emergency service organizations. Topics include risk evaluation and control procedures for fire stations, training sites, emergency vehicles and emergency situations involving fire, EMS, hazardous materials, and technical rescue. Upon completion of this course, students should be able to establish and manage a safety program in an emergency service.

Credits: 3

Lab Hours: 0.00
Lecture Hours: 3.00
